Personalization continues to be a big hit among trendsetting gadget lovers,
so Samsung just launched two new BlackJack II handsets dipped in pastel colors.
The very corporate BlackJack II equipped with Windows Mobile 6 is currently
available to executives everywhere in black and red wine colors, but today, AT&T
took the wraps off a fun, two-toned version for the weekend warrior.
The Ocean Blue and Romantic Pink BlackJack IIs feature unique contrasting designs along with color coordinated keys to match the either blue or pink
hues on the back of the phone. Everything else is pretty much the same: QWERTY
keyboard, a 2.4-inch QVGA color display, jog wheel, built-in GPS, 2.0 megapixel
camera, video capture, RSS reader, 3G, and more. Both are now available through
AT&T for $99 with a two-year contract, which is cheaper than the original
asking price of the black or wine BlackJack II handsets.
